A two car wreck at the intersection of Stevenson Mill Road and the 68-80 Bypass left an Auburn man dead and a warrant issued for the arrest of a Tennessee woman Saturday.

According to the Logan County Sheriff's Department, 80-year-old Carl Hodges of Auburn was traveling on the 68-80 Bypass when he was struck by Margie Johnson, 47, of Springfield, Tenn., who failed to yield at the stop sign on Stevenson Mill Road.

The impact from the collision caused Hodges's vehicle to strike a guardrail, thus resulting in him being ejected from his vehicle, which overturned in the roadway.

Hodges was transported to Vanderbilt University Hospital in Nashville, Tenn. where he was pronounced deceased upon arrival.

Johnson was transported to Vanderbilt University Hospital in Nashville, Tenn. for injuries sustained in the crash.

An arrest warrant was issued for Johnson for operating a motor vehicle under the influence (aggravating circumstances) murder, as well as other criminal charges.

The accident is being investigated by Sgt. Clint Wright of the Logan County Sheriff's Department. He was assisted by deputies Parker Rowland, Kory McDonald, Billy Poole, and Jason Brent also of the Logan County Sheriff's Department, as well as the Russellville Police Department, the Russellville Fire Department, Logan County EMS and Air Evac.
